well we can use the regular image element to place images on earth like we usually do the picture element opens up the world of art direction for when were placing images on it so we can actually bring in a different image for on your on a phone a tablet or your desktop computer so when its you know you can go from portrait to landscape and do all sorts of sort of fun stuff like that so heres a fun example from Google where you can see its actually changing the image thats being loaded in based on the screen size now its not doing this with media queries where its hiding one image and showing the other one which you can kill bandwidth because it would have to load in all three images and to show you one at a time using the picture element were actually loading in one image depending on the screen size so this is all done in the markup its not being done at all with CSS and its loading only in the image that it needs to and this is just a fun example of you know the Google th

The image position in CSS can be changed by using CSS properties like object-position property and float property. Object-position property is used to align the position with respect to the x,y coordinates of the image within its container.

You can use two values top and left along with the position property to move an HTML element anywhere in the HTML document....Relative Positioning Move Left - Use a negative value for left. Move Right - Use a positive value for left. Move Up - Use a negative value for top. Move Down - Use a positive value for top.

To auto-resize an image or a video to fit in a div container use object-fit property. It is used to specify how an image or video fits in the container. object-fit property: This property is used to specify how an image or video resize and fit the container.
Another way is to simply use background-image on the container instead, but resizing it (if you want to stretch smaller images) will be difficult unless you use background-size which isn't fully supported. Otherwise, it's a great easy solution.

One of the simplest ways to resize an image in the HTML is using the height and width attributes on the img tag. These values specify the height and width of the image element. The values are set in px i.e. CSS pixels.
